People's Park Snapdragon

In the bustling and noisy city center, Nanning People's Park is like a tranquil oasis, and the snapdragons in it are a unique touch of bright color.
Step into People's Park and stroll along the winding paths, feeling the breeze on your face and bringing the fragrance of grass and trees. Inadvertently, you can catch a glimpse of the corner where snapdragons are planted. Snapdragon, the name sounds smart and playful, and when you actually see it, you will feel that it lives up to its name.

They grow in clumps and clusters. The plants are not tall, but have various shapes. On the slender stems, the flowers are arranged in an orderly manner, like small goldfish connected head to tail. Against the backdrop of green leaves, they seem to be swimming happily. Some flowers are pink, just like the shy cheeks of a girl, with a bit of coquettishness and gentleness; some are bright yellow, like the warm spring sun, full of liveliness and enthusiasm; and some are white, like pure snowflakes, showing simplicity and elegance.

The breeze blew gently, and the snapdragons swayed slightly, as if they were really wagging their tails and playing in the water. Looking closely, each flower has an exquisite structure. The edges of the petals are slightly curled, like a goldfish's nimble tail, and the flower body is bulging, just like the goldfish's round body. The center of the flower is dotted with tender stamens, as if they were bubbles spit out by a goldfish, adding a bit of interest to this vivid picture.
The snapdragons in People's Park are not only a beautiful gift from nature to the city, but also a place of comfort for people's souls. In the busy urban life, they bring people the beauty and tranquility of nature with their unique posture, becoming an unforgettable brilliant color in the city.
